What Drives the Gold Price?

Gold prices are influenced by a blend of global and regional factors. In Dubai, these prices often mirror international market movements but are also affected by local demand, currency fluctuations, and government policies.

1. Global Market Influence:
The global spot price of gold, quoted in US dollars per ounce, is the primary benchmark. When international markets experience volatility—due to geopolitical tensions, inflation fears, or changes in US Federal Reserve policies—gold often acts as a safe-haven asset, driving prices higher.

2. Currency Dynamics:
Since gold is priced in dollars globally, the exchange rate between the USD and the UAE dirham (which is pegged to USD) usually remains stable in Dubai. However, fluctuations in regional currencies indirectly impact pricing through demand shifts.

3. Local Demand and Supply:
Dubai hosts one of the world’s largest gold souks and numerous jewelry manufacturers. Festivals, wedding seasons, and cultural events increase local demand, sometimes pushing prices up locally despite stable international prices.

4. Government Policies and Taxes:
Dubai benefits from zero Value Added Tax (VAT) on gold bullion, which keeps prices competitive compared to other international markets. However, occasional regulatory changes can influence market sentiments.

Why Invest in Gold in Dubai?

Benefits of Investing in Gold in Dubai

1. Competitive Pricing:
Dubai’s gold prices are often lower compared to many global markets due to minimal taxation and high volume trading.

2. Authenticity and Assay Standards:
Gold sold in Dubai comes with strict quality certifications. The Dubai Central Laboratory and the Gold & Jewellery Group ensure authenticity and provide hallmarking, giving investors peace of mind.

3. Liquidity and Accessibility:
The city’s gold market operates 24/7 with ease of buying and selling, backed by an organized market infrastructure.

4. Variety of Investment Options:
Investors can choose from physical gold (bars, coins, jewelry), gold ETFs, and gold futures available through the Dubai Gold and Commodities Exchange (DGCX).

How to Get the Best Deals on Gold in Dubai Today

1. Monitor the Daily Gold Price Updates

Stay informed by regularly checking reliable sources such as the Dubai Gold and Jewellery Group, reputable banks, and international financial news portals. Gold prices can fluctuate multiple times a day, so timing your purchase can make a substantial difference.

2. Buy Directly from Authorized Dealers and the Gold Souk

Dubai’s famous Gold Souk offers competitive pricing because of the large volume of trade. However, always verify seller credentials and check for hallmark certifications.

3. Avoid Premiums on Jewelry Unless Necessary

While gold jewelry is appealing, it carries additional making charges and design premiums. For investment purposes, pure gold bars or coins with minimal premiums are financially wiser.

4. Opt for 24k Gold for Pure Investment

24-carat gold has the highest purity (99.9%) and is preferred by investors rather than lower-carat jewelry, which can have mixed metal content.

5. Negotiate and Compare Quotes

Don’t hesitate to negotiate prices, especially for bulk purchases, and always compare quotes from multiple dealers to ensure you get the best rate.

6. Time Your Purchases According to Market Trends

Many experienced investors wait for dips in international gold prices before buying. Seasonal slowdowns (like post-festival months) can also be good buying opportunities.

Gold Investment Strategies for Dubai Buyers

Physical Gold Investment

Buying physical gold—bars and coins—is popular for tangible asset holding. Make sure to get official certificates and store your gold securely in bank lockers or trusted vaults.

Gold ETFs and Digital Gold

For convenience, investors can purchase gold ETFs listed on international exchanges or local platforms that allow fractional ownership without physical handling.

Participation in Gold Futures on DGCX

For advanced investors, gold futures contracts traded on the Dubai Gold and Commodities Exchange enable speculation on future price movements or hedging against inflation.

FAQ: Gold Price Dubai Today

Q1: Where can I check the most accurate gold prices in Dubai today?

A: Visit official sites like the Dubai Gold and Jewellery Group or consult major banks and bullion dealers’ platforms for real-time updates.

Q2: Does Dubai charge VAT on gold purchases?

A: No, bullion gold remains exempt from VAT in Dubai, although jewelry may attract VAT on the making charges.

Q3: Is it better to invest in gold bars or jewelry in Dubai?

A: For investment, gold bars are preferable because they have lower premiums and higher liquidity than jewelry.

Q4: Can tourists buy gold in Dubai at competitive prices?

A: Yes, tourists often enjoy attractive prices, but it’s essential to check local customs regulations before taking gold abroad.

Q5: How does the global gold price affect Dubai’s gold price?

A: Dubai’s gold prices largely track global spot prices but include minor local factors such as demand and currency exchange.
